Output 43b279f4c112b1a804eefd6952e9938f37677bc7a8edf79a574a8558243afeff:5

value
10356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e89940fb5666d3ea6ec20b0821bd26c5fc985e2 OP_EQUAL
address
331tCLmsTDH51WbVa4nfvfbw6zBj7qnbhj
transaction
43b279f4c112b1a804eefd6952e9938f37677bc7a8edf79a574a8558243afeff
confirmations
166513
spent
true